Revolutionary Advanced Laser Cleaning for Wood Materials
The emerging field of laser cleaning provides a remarkably accurate solution for restoring and preserving delicate wood artifacts. Unlike standard abrasive cleaning approaches that can inflict significant damage, advanced laser cleaning utilizes focused light pulses to gently ablate contaminants such as pollution, old lacquers, and even layers of tarnish. This touchless process minimizes the risk of scratching or altering the authentic wood texture, a critical factor in historical conservation and furniture renovation. The flexible wavelength and power settings allow experts to tailor the cleaning procedure to a wide spectrum of wood varieties and the severity of the soiling. Furthermore, laser cleaning typically produces minimal debris, making it a greater environmentally green option than several other cleaning systems. It's a exceptionally promising innovation for safeguarding our wood heritage.
